I'm not ready to call it yet. I don't know if the one I have is a bad amp or not, but it was seriously ugly on the fixed resistors (like the AD-1 amp dyno).

It made 80v clean UNLOADED, but man... as soon as I put a load on it, it went to shit. It was ugly.

I could NOT make it do clean power. It did 2600w @ 1 ohm fixed with 57% efficiency at the gain position where I set it unloaded, but good lord the distortion. And it got hot as fish grease in no time.

I eased the load to 2.5 ohms and STILL couldn't get it clean under load.

Here's a screen shot of the video. This is like volume nothing on the HU. It's making 6.7 ac volts at 2.5 ohms here. With a clean 13.6v from the power supply and drawing ~ 6A. That's a whopping 18w and the wave is here...



Dirty much?

Here's the screen shot of the 1ohm fixed load test. 51v would be great if it was clean.



I'm not sure what's going on with this thing.
